Super Mario Maker is a new title from Nintendo where, for the first time ever, you will be able to create your own levels on your own console. The game released on September 11th, 2015.

Through Nintendo Directs, Nintendo Treehouse videos, and the Super Mario Maker website, there's quite a bit of information out now which is really showcasing how deep the creation tools are.

Four Main Themes To Choose From!
Super Mario Bros., Super Mario Bros. 3, Super Mario World, New Super Mario Bros. U

What's really incredible is the slew of classic objects found inside. When an item wasn't part of a previous or later game theme, Nintendo has taken the time to make new sprites to allow you to always be able to switch on the fly from theme to theme. Some classic objects include, Goombas, Monty Moles, Invisible Blocks, Flagpoles, and so much more!


The man who was alongside Miyamoto all these years with the Super Mario series, Takashi Tezuka, is the producer of this game. Koji Kondo, acclaimed Nintendo-music composer, is again the lead composer of this game. Really addicted to the game so far. It's easy to just jump in and want to play other people's games. It also gives you great ideas on how to make your own.

There are some things I hope they address as the game goes on. Namely:
- I'd like my friends' levels to be selectable from a list.
- Context sensitive question blocks. Like someone said: If you're small Mario, a mushroom comes out. If you're big Mario, a flower/feather comes out. I think question blocks should be like this by default, and they can save "THIS BLOCK IS ALWAYS A FEATHER" for Exclamation Blocks instead.
- It would be neat to have level completion from a miniboss. I'd love to be able to beat a Bowser Jr. and then have the level end. It's a little weird to have levels end normally on an airship or what have you.
- More playable characters, but that's kind of a no brainer. It'd be great to be Luigi and Peach, each with their own abilities.
- Slopes. Definitely slopes.
- More terrain packs - tropical, ice worlds, desert, etc. I'm sure all this stuff will come in DLC.

Basically whatever they release for DLC for this game, I will be ALL over it. I can't really reiterate how addicting just playing random levels is. It's like a never ending, super unpredictable Mario game.
